Ploughing Awards

Following the recent Ploughing Day at Vale Farm, two awards have been made to those who demonstrated their ploughing skills at the event. These were made at the latest Friday Night gathering at the Village Hall where the presentations were made by Chris Thomas.

The “Duke of Denton Cup”, created many years ago for local ploughing competitions but only recently returned to the village, went to the Best Ploughman of the Day, John Chapman. Not the one currently resident on Trunch Hill but another JC who used to live on Norwich Road but moved away some time ago. In accepting the trophy he said how great it was to be back in the village again.

The other award went to the youngest competitor, Alex Bolderston, aged 13, of Chapelfield. Despite his youth, and commitment to goat husbandry, he had demonstrated his skills as a tractor driver in a most impressive way. As you can see, his prize was some guidance on how to do it even better!
